Qualitative research designs refer to systematic plans


or frameworks that guide the collection, analysis, and
interpretation of qualitative data. Qualitative research
is concerned with exploring and understanding the
complexities of human experiences, behaviors, and
phenomena in their natural contexts.

Com m on qua l i t a t i ve re se a r c h de s i gns i nc l ude :

Phenomenological research: Focuses on understanding the lived


experiences of individuals or groups and uncovering the essence or
meaning of those experiences.

Ethnographic research: Involves immersive observation and interaction


within a cultural or social group to understand their behaviors,
practices, and beliefs within their natural context.
GUIDE CARD 2

Grounded theory: Aims to develop theoretical frameworks or


explanations grounded in the data collected, often through iterative
cycles of data collection, coding, and analysis.

Case study: In-depth examination of a single individual, group,


organization, or phenomenon to explore complex interactions and
contextual factors.

These designs are not mutually exclusive, and researchers may


combine elements from different approaches to suit their research
objectives and the nature of the phenomenon under investigation.
Additionally, qualitative research designs prioritize the use of
various data collection techniques such as interviews, focus
groups, observations, and document analysis to gather rich and
detailed insights into the research topic.
